About the role

  • Own enablement across the business
  • Develop persuasive marketing assets for Sales, Customer Success, and Agency and Tech partners
  • Create and evolve sales and partner enablement assets such as decks, one-pagers, talk tracks, case studies, and playbooks
  • Translate product updates, positioning, and market insights into clear materials
  • Partner closely with Orita teammates in Sales, CS, Partnerships
  • Help shape voice in the market by turning strong ideas into content
  • Develop thought leadership that leverages expertise
  • Write and edit content across formats
  • Run experiments to learn what works
  • Create systems that make it easier to move quickly without losing clarity
  • Help turn what works today into repeatable loops
  • Launch Orita to new platforms and channels

Requirements

  • 6–10+ years of experience in marketing, ideally in B2B SaaS or high-growth startups
  • Strong storytelling, writing and editing skills, with comfort owning work end to end
  • Owned enablement for a customer-facing or partner-facing function (Sales, Customer Success, agencies, or similar), including creating and maintaining the core assets those teams rely on.
  • Written customer case studies end to end, including working directly with customers, incorporating feedback, and getting final approval for publication.
  • Built or evolved sales or partner decks and talk tracks that were actively used in live conversations and deals.
  • Turned complex or technical product capabilities into clear narratives that non-technical audiences could understand and act on.
  • Owned content marketing programs beyond blog writing, including editorial planning, prioritization, and distribution.
  • Pitched thought leadership ideas and saw them through to execution (published content, events, talks, webinars, or panels), with measurable impact
  • Written or edited content that was reused across sales, partnerships, lifecycle, or enablement, not just a single channel.
  • Worked closely with cross-functional partners to refine messaging based on real-world feedback from customers or prospects.
  • Managed multiple initiatives at once and made clear tradeoffs about what mattered most when timelines or priorities shifted.
